A fast-track court in Uttar Pradesh’s Mainpuri district has delivered judgment in the nearly 20-year-old case of the kidnapping and murder of Class 10 student Sunil Tomar. The court convicted three accused—Ravi Mishra, Aakrosh Gupta, and Yogendra Kashyap—and sentenced them to rigorous life imprisonment along with a fine of ₹55,000 each.

According to District Government Counsel Pushpendra Singh Chauhan, Sunil went missing on the evening of December 31, 2005. Despite extensive searches, he could not be found. The next day, his body was recovered near Jalalpur village. Following a complaint by Sunil’s brother, Deepu Tomar, five individuals were named in the FIR.

Two of the accused—Shailendra Yadav and Shailendra Kashyap—are still absconding, and their case files have been separated. After completing the investigation, police filed the chargesheet, based on which the fast-track court pronounced the conviction and sentences.
